Which side of the plane to sit from Shanghai Pudong International Airport (Shanghai) to Hyakuri Airport (Ibaraki)?
Left Side of the Plane
The left side provides the most iconic views, specifically the majestic Mount Fuji and the vast urban landscape of the Tokyo metropolitan area as you approach Ibaraki.
Yangtze River Estuary
View the massive silt-laden waters of the Yangtze delta meeting the clear blue East China Sea shortly after takeoff.
Japanese Southern Alps
Distant views of the snow-capped peaks of central Honshu, including some of Japan's highest mountains.
Mount Fuji
The quintessential view of Japan's most famous peak, visible on the left side during the descent toward the Kanto region.
Greater Tokyo Area
The endless urban sprawl of the world's most populous metropolitan area stretching toward the horizon.
Mount Tsukuba
A distinctive double-peaked mountain that serves as a landmark for the final approach into Hyakuri Airport.
Book an 'A' window seat for the best panoramic views. Mount Fuji typically appears roughly 30 to 45 minutes before landing. Afternoon flights are ideal as the sun will be on the opposite side of the aircraft, providing perfect lighting for photography of the landscape.
Goto Islands
The first glimpse of Japanese territory, featuring rugged island coastlines in the East China Sea.
Izu Peninsula
A beautiful view of the mountainous peninsula known for its dramatic cliffs and hot spring towns.
Izu Oshima
A large active volcanic island in the Pacific Ocean with a visible central caldera.
Tokyo Bay
Observe the heavy maritime traffic, industrial ports, and the impressive Tokyo Bay Aqua-Line bridge.
Boso Peninsula
Green hills and coastal scenery of Chiba Prefecture as the plane turns north toward Ibaraki.
The right side ('F' or 'K' seats) is excellent for viewing the Pacific coastline and volcanic islands. This side is preferable on morning flights to avoid direct sunlight and glare, allowing for a clearer view of the deep blue ocean and coastal geography.
